Course Description

The course covers both semesters of the senior year. Students work in teams of three to six members each. The fall semester is generally devoted to related lectures and doing background research for the problem assigned and then designing a suitable solution to the problem. The spring semester is devoted to construction and testing of the design. In the case of the contests, designs compete with designs from other universities under the sponsorship of recognized engineering societies. In the process they experience many phases encountered in engineering practice such as dealing with suppliers, ordering supplies, handling purchase orders, securing delivery and other related responsibilities.

Students are expected to approach the project with enthusiasm and a strong interest, develop their native creative abilities, and utilize their engineering theory and knowledge. Projects originate from many sources. Some are contests sponsored by technical societies. Some are projects suggested by outside interests, some by faculty, some by the students themselves. Some of the best have been suggested by the students. For that reason we encourage students to come up with ideas of their own and if they have friends they want to work with, organize their own team. Once the project is selected by a team of students, they are responsible for the completion of every phase of the project.
